#f1e28c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f1e28c is composed of 94.5% red, 88.6% green and 54.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 6.2% magenta, 41.9%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 51.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.3% and a lightness of 74.7%. #f1e28c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#e3c519.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c99.

#f1e28c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f1e28c has RGB values of R:241, G:226, B:140 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.06, Y:0.42,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15852172.
